Flame-shaped hemorrhages are located in the nerve fiber layer. Dot and blot hemorrhages are located in the Outer plexiform layer - Inner nuclear layer (OPL-INL)complex. WebHypetension, Diabetes, or other systemic vascular condition If a medical condition causes issues with blood flow, then it can cause bleeding inside the eye. Diabetic retinopathy tends to cause multiple pinpoint dot hemorrhages, whereas hypertensive retinopathy tends to be associated with larger flame shaped hemorrhages. WebHemorrhage, hypoxia, hypoperfusion, fluctuations in vascular pressures and vascular dysfunction may all contribute to retinal nerve fiber layer infarcts, disruption of axoplasmic flow (resulting in cotton wool spots), micro-embolization of platelet aggregates (resulting in Roth spots) and retinal vein occlusions.
